MY VRP SET-UP
Well Everyone...My patience has paid off yielding a full fledged monster VRP Style!!!!!
BIG THANKS TO VADIM FOR HIS PERSITANCE AND ALSO LONING ME HIS S600 TANK
Just a quick rundown for everyone. I previously had an existing tune on my car from the previous owner which was a Kleemann tune. I added an ASP Pulley and VRP's original shorty headers. I made 452whp with this setup.
3 Months later.......
I have gone full fledged VRP.
I have changed to VRP's new pulley design, I have swapped my old shorty headers with the new design and changed my tune to powerchip / VRP.
Vadim will have to chime in and hopefully post the dyno from today. My car made somewhere around 477whp.
My reasoning for switching from ASP was I just didn't feel that confident with it. I know many run an ASP pulley with Zero problem so I will leave that topic for another time.
With my old set-up I ran a 12.32 at LV Motor Speedway. I will try and make it out to another track day somewhere (CA or NV) and see how she does.
Thanks for listning.
p.s. I forgot to mention, I am even getting better MPG.....or at least I was before the foot hit the firewall.

Firstly, Evan... CONGRATS! I hope you are enjoying the new found power!!
With respect to the 1/4mile times and the performance...
The white E55 that has the VR675 did trap 128mph @ Montreal track. He has repeatedly run against other 55 cars and obliterated them. He hasnt taken it to any other track, but that is where he runs all his cars so he is happy with what it is running and isn't interested in proving anything more.. He has offered to let me take it anywhere I want to run it or test it, but I just haven't made it back to Montreal to do anything so far.
Nate's car is a custom tune job.. he has added a bunch of parts to the car and we were trying to get him a tune that works .. he trapped low because he still has some torque limit issues... at 5,000RPM the A/F dives down to 10:1 and the car cuts power which is why its falling on its face up top.. The ECU is back in our hands and we are making adjustments.
Fleebee's car had a bad MAP sensor which was causing repeated CELs. It took us a while to find the problem but since putting in a brand new MAP sensor the car has not thrown any CELs and seems to be running stronger.. I am sure he will be heading back to the track now that the car is healthy.
Even JakPro's VR700 had to have the MAP sensor replaced. Hopefully he gets a chance to run it down the 1/4mile and see what it can do.
Jim's SL55 has run 11.9 @ 120mph with VR600.
Unfortunately we don't have anyone on the board that participates in regular track events to be able to post up the outcomes.
We just retuned Marcus' car and switched it over from the LET software to ours. He will be heading to the track and posting the info. His car is a 2005 with basic pulley + ECU + a front mount H/E that was custom made for him. He is an avid drag racer and enthusiast so he will have some feedback for us.
There alot more customer cars that are being completed so I am sure you will see more and more feedback in the coming months.
